While Banning Engineering serves many municipal clients across Indiana, the firm got its start in residential and commercial site development. That was the service Jeff Banning knew he could deliver better, and at a fairer price, than what the market was offering at the time. Site development became the foundation the company was built on, and it remains central to who we are today. 

Site Development Vice President Steve Brehob and his staff have not only carried that work forward, they have grown it. Our team and our client base have both expanded significantly. We continue to serve many local developers who have worked with us for years, and we have also become the engineering partner of choice for most of the large national home builders and developers active in this market. 

For decades, Banning Engineering has provided services in Morgan, Hendricks, Marion, and Hamilton Counties. Today that footprint includes Delaware County, where we are working in and around Muncie. Every development project has two sets of expectations to satisfy: the client’s, and the community’s. Developers need buildable lots and a realistic timeline. Municipalities need stormwater that works, streets that connect, and infrastructure that will hold up long after the last house sells. Our role is to design plans that meet both. Banning Engineering has been doing that work across Central Indiana for decades.

Our site development success does not stand alone. Banning Engineering relies on a highly qualified Survey Department to move these projects forward. Survey Vice President Jon Polson has assembled a high caliber team whose work supports nearly every phase of site development, from boundary and topographic surveys through final plats and construction staking.
